95. Deputy Malcolm Byrne asked the Minister for Enterprise, Tourism and Employment further to recent Government approval, the engagement his Department has had with the Department of Health and the Health Service Executive regarding the planned procurement of a national electronic health record system; whether he considers that AI-enabled components within such a system would fall within the “high-risk” category under the EU AI Act;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[31252/26]
